All Local Guide
Welch Electrical Systems
Adress
190 Pleasant St
(781) 878-6001
Related Businesses
Glynn Electric
250 Vfw Drive Apartment 20
E C A Electric Construction
23 Hingham St
Welch Electrical Systems
190 Pleasant St
Gone Green Electrical LLC
35 Deering Square
Custom Electrical Services
34 Norman St